Pipe repl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or deteriorating pipes and installing new piping systems to ensure proper water flow and drainage throughout a property. This process typically includes inspecting existing pipes for issues, removing sections that are corroded or cracked, and fitting new pipes made from durable materials suited to the property's needs. The goal is to restore the integrity of the plumbing system, reduce leaks, and prevent future problems that can lead to costly repairs or water damage.
These services are essential for addressing common plumbing problems such as persistent leaks, low water pressure, frequent clogs, or pipe corrosion. Over time, pipes can become worn out due to age, mineral buildup, or exposure to harsh conditions, which may compromise their function and cause water quality issues. Replacing aging or damaged pipes can help eliminate ongoing leaks, improve water flow, and prevent pipe bursts that could cause significant property damage.

The overview below groups typical Pipe Replacement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kennewick,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or pipe repairs or replacements in Kennewick often range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on pipe material and accessibility.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less additional work is needed.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of aging or damaged pipes us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ers most standard projects where only part of the plumbing system requires attention. Larger or more complex partial replacements can exceed this range.
Full Pipe Replacement - Complete replacement of an entire plumbing line generally costs from $4,000 to $8,000 in the Kennewick area. Many full replacements fall into this range, but highly complex or extensive projects can push costs higher, especially in older homes.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more involved pipe replacement projects, such as rerouting or replacing main lines,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ve additional factors like excavation or extensive remodeling.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What signs indicate a pipe may need replacement? Signs such as persistent leaks, low water pressure, frequent clogs, or visible pipe corrosion can suggest that a pipe replacement might be necessary. Local contractors can assess these issues to determine the best solution.
What types of pipes are typically replaced during a pipe replacement service? Commonly replaced pipes include supply lines, drain pipes, and sewer lines, often made from materials like PVC, copper, or cast iron, depending on the home's plumbing system.
